2. CASE on warranty: John sold a pair of skis to Bob, making no specific warranties or promises of any kind other than letting Bob examine and try them. In fact, John did not own the skis; he had only rented them. When the true owner claimed them, Bob demanded his money back. John defended his actions by stating that he had made no warranty of any kind. There was no paper with authorized signature. a) Demonstrate your knowledge about implied warranty of title from the above case? (5 marks) b) Suggest a solution to make express warranty clearer.
